技术文摘
MySQL 数据表操作方法全解析
2025-01-15 03:25:38 小编
MySQL 作为一款广泛使用的关系型数据库管理系统,对数据表的操作是数据库管理与开发的基础。深入理解并掌握这些操作方法,对于提升数据库性能和数据处理效率至关重要。
创建数据表是使用 MySQL 的首要操作。通过 CREATE TABLE 语句,用户可以定义表的结构,包括列名、数据类型、约束条件等。例如,要创建一个存储用户信息的表,可以这样写:
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(50) NOT NULL,
email VARCHAR(100) UNIQUE,
age INT
);
这段代码中,定义了一个名为 users 的表,包含四个列,分别用于存储用户的唯一标识、用户名、邮箱和年龄。其中,id 列设置了自增属性并作为主键,username 列不允许为空,email 列必须唯一。
插入数据是向数据表填充信息的操作。使用 INSERT INTO 语句,可以将数据插入到指定的表中。单条数据插入示例如下:
INSERT INTO users (username, email, age) VALUES ('JohnDoe', 'john@example.com', 30);
如果要插入多条数据,只需在 VALUES 关键字后使用逗号分隔多条记录即可。
查询数据是最常用的数据表操作之一。使用 SELECT 语句,可以根据各种条件从表中检索数据。例如,查询所有用户信息:
SELECT * FROM users;
若只想查询特定列,可以指定列名,如:
SELECT username, email FROM users;
还可以通过 WHERE 子句添加过滤条件,例如查询年龄大于 25 岁的用户:
SELECT * FROM users WHERE age > 25;
更新和删除数据也是重要的操作。UPDATE 语句用于修改表中的数据,例如将用户 JohnDoe 的年龄更新为 31:
UPDATE users SET age = 31 WHERE username = 'JohnDoe';
DELETE 语句则用于删除表中的数据,比如删除用户名为 JaneDoe 的记录:
DELETE FROM users WHERE username = 'JaneDoe';
掌握 MySQL 数据表的各种操作方法,能让开发者和数据库管理员更加高效地管理和利用数据,为构建稳定、高效的应用程序提供坚实的基础。无论是小型项目还是大型企业级应用,这些操作技巧都是不可或缺的。
- Go1.18 Beta1 发布 泛型版已然到来
- 动画 ViewPropertyAnimator 的使用与原理深度解析
- 90 后游戏开发天才毛星云跳楼身亡 8 年国产 3A 梦破碎
- Sentry 前端(ReactJS 生态)开发者贡献指引
- 元宇宙会是人类的“死路”吗?
- 中国移动新专利公布 意在增强 VR 设备内容服务水平
- JS 六种打断点的方式,你知晓多少?
- Webpack 原理与实践:Webpack 解决的问题探究
- 经典 IT 风险评估框架,哪种适合您?
- 用 100 行代码达成 React 核心调度功能
- 易被忽略的 Flex 属性 Align-Content
- C 语言内存分配漫谈
- 安卓逆向:手把手教你篡改 Apk 名称与图标
- 元宇宙逊于艾泽拉斯
- MovieMat:基于场景数据的电影推荐之道